HELD UNDER THE GENERAL COMPETITION RULES OF THE MOTOR CYCLE UNION OF IRELAND LTD. AND THESE SUPPLEMENTARY REGULATIONS.

  1. The trial will be held over a number of laps of a circuit. On each lap the competitor will be required to negotiate a number of observed sections. The number of laps will be stated before the start.
  2. 2. Marks will be as follows. Clean passage - Nil marks, 1 dab - 1 mark, 2 dabs - 2 marks, more than 2 dabs - 3 marks, failure in section - 5 marks. A dab shall mean touching the ground with any part of the body. THE OBSERVERS DECISION IS FINAL
  3. Punch card method of recording marks lost will be used.
  4. Sections will be indicated by coloured markers placed in pairs. Blue will denote the lefthand boundary of the section and
    Red the Righthand. White markers will indicate the finish of the section and yellow the start. Competitors must pass between such markers. Front spindle IN, front spindle OUT method of marking will be used. The onus of following the correct course rests with the competitor, but all the sections must be attempted in their correct order.
  5. No practising, either on or before the day of the event will be permitted. Any competitor found
    Doing so will be disqualified.
  6. Machines to be fitted with standard tyres not exceeding 4 cross section and unaltered in any way.
  7. All competitors must be in possession of a current competition licence, which must be available for inspection.
  8. Helmets as per M.C.U.I. regulations must be worn.
  9. In the event of a tie, the competitor with the most cleans will be the winner. If the tie still exists the most 'ones', then the most 'two's' will be taken into account.
  10. Any competitor injured in this event (excluding Juniors) may claim benevolent fund by submitting a form obtained from the club secretary within 14 days of the event.
  11. A Junior event will run concurrently.
